Iraq beat Saudi Arabia to win Asian Cup
Iraq have won the Asian Cup for the first time after defeating Saudi Arabia 1-0. Captain Younes Mahmoud headed the winning goal from a 72nd minute corner. The Iraqi squad includes Kurds, Sunnis, Shias and Turkomans. The players had faced kidnap ...

FIFA World Rankings: Proud finish sends Iraq flying
Monthly list for AUGUST --- With Iraq's fairy tale AFC Asian Cup 2007 conquest still fresh on the lips of football fans the world over, it is no surprise that they have been rewarded by a 16-place shoot up to 64th on the latest FIFA/Coca-Cola World Ranking. The milestone achievement further cemented Iraq's status as one of Asia's top footballing nations...
